Generally, oil changes used to be recommended every 3,500 miles. If you drive an older vehicle and use synthetic oil or are simply extra-catious, this may still be a best-practice for you. That being said, in the majority of newer Nissan vehicles, you will not need an oil change until you’ve reached about 5,000-7,500 miles after your last one.
